Indonesian fashion has undergone significant changes over the years, reflecting the country's cultural diversity and modernization. Traditional Indonesian clothing, such as Batik and Kebaya, is still widely worn, with many designers incorporating traditional elements into their designs.
Indonesian television, too, has become increasingly popular, with a range of local and international shows being broadcast across the country. Soap operas, known as sinetron, are extremely popular, with many Indonesian dramas being produced and aired on local television channels. The hit sinetron "Anugerah Terindah Yang Pernah Kumiliki" (The Most Beautiful Gift I've Ever Had) was a massive success, attracting millions of viewers nationwide. As Indonesian entertainment and popular culture continue to evolve, there are both challenges and opportunities on the horizon. With the rise of digital platforms, Indonesian artists and creatives have greater access to global audiences, but they also face increased competition and piracy.
The Indonesian government has implemented initiatives to support the growth of the country's creative industries, including the establishment of the Ministry of Tourism's Creative Economy Agency. This agency aims to promote Indonesian creative industries, including music, film, and fashion, globally.
